Transaction 05145b592b99a3f144095edd51002b600ae13c5c476a88d6efe5c45a4d142e67
1 Input
1 Output
-
05145b592b99a3f144095edd51002b600ae13c5c476a88d6efe5c45a4d142e67:0
- value
- 12905524
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e237a45f36c425cbf72ab4056c1e89789aeab2b
- address
- bc1q8c3h530nd3p9e0mj4dq9ds0gj7y6a2et7z2hw6